For this kitchen update, the client requested (1) white quartz countertops with (2) a colorful backsplash with minimal grout lines and (3) removing her cooktop to make space for a range.
We found a beautiful blue tile in a 12″x24″ size, which we installed vertically to offer a colorful and minimal grout solution!

Here is a quick before and after picture of the overall changes. There is a lot going on in this picture that you might not notice! We not only removed the cooktop, but also the built-in oven. Joseph made two new doors to cover the open cabinet from the oven and added wood to the existing cabinet to box in the range. The carpentry was a lot of delicate work, but it turned out great!
